Why we cap the price instead of running a clock

Most removalists charge by the hour. It sounds fair, and it looks cheap on the phone, but it quietly puts every delay on your side of the ledger. Traffic, a tight stairwell, a lift that is booked out, a crew that takes its time: all of it adds to your bill, and none of it is in your control once the truck arrives.

We do it the other way around. We work out your move up front and agree a cap in writing. As long as what we're moving matches the list you gave us, your move can come in under the cap but it will not go over. If the job runs long, the extra hours are on us, not on your bill. That puts the risk of a slow day where it belongs, with us, and it means the price you were quoted is the price you can plan your whole move around.

The questions worth asking any mover

What makes you different from a cheaper removalist?

The things that go wrong on moving day are the things cheaper movers leave out of the quote. We include them as standard: a capped price in writing, background-checked movers, all materials, and full insurance. A lower hourly rate often means one of those is missing, and you find out on the day.

Are your movers employees or subcontractors?

The crew on your job is our own, trained by us and background-checked. We do not hand your move to day labour hired off an app that morning, so you know who is coming before they arrive.

What is the Capped-Price Promise?

We agree a price cap in writing before we start. As long as what we're moving matches the list you gave us, your move can come in under the cap but it will not go over. If the job runs long, the extra hours are on us, not on your bill.

What happens if something gets damaged?

Everything fragile is double-wrapped, and every job carries transit and goods-in-care insurance. In the rare event we mark something, we fix or replace it without a fight.

Do you charge extra for stairs, heavy items or fuel?

No. What we quote is what you pay. We do not bolt on a stairs charge, a heavy-item fee or a fuel levy once we are there. Those are the surprise costs the cap exists to protect you from.
